如何提高网页的加载速度

提高网页加载速度的关键在于优化图片、压缩代码和利用缓存。首先,压缩图片并使用现代格式如WebP减少文件大小。其次,精简HTML、CSS和JavaScript代码,删除冗余部分。最后,利用浏览器缓存和CDN服务,减少服务器负载和响应时间。这些措施能有效提升用户体验和SEO排名。

imagesource from: pexels

提高网页加载速度:提升用户体验与SEO排名的关键

在现代互联网时代,网页加载速度不仅是用户体验的重要指标,更是影响SEO排名的关键因素。研究表明,超过53%的用户会在网页加载超过3秒后选择离开,这不仅导致潜在客户的流失,还会直接影响搜索引擎的排名。Google等搜索引擎早已将加载速度作为排名算法的一部分,强调提高加载速度的紧迫性和重要性。通过引用权威数据和案例,如亚马逊发现每增加100毫秒的加载时间,销售额就会下降1%,可见优化网页加载速度不仅关乎用户体验,更是商业成功的基石。本文将深入探讨如何通过优化图片、精简代码和利用缓存等多种手段,全面提升网页加载速度,助你在激烈的市场竞争中脱颖而出。

一、优化图片:减少文件大小的关键

1、选择合适的图片格式:WebP的优势

在网页加载速度的优化中,图片格式的选择至关重要。WebP作为一种现代图片格式,凭借其高效的压缩算法,能在保证图片质量的同时大幅减少文件大小。相比传统的JPEG和PNG格式,WebP可以节省约30%的存储空间,这对于提升网页加载速度具有重要意义。例如,一张普通的JPEG图片大小为2MB,转换为WebP格式后,大小可能降至1.4MB,显著减少了数据传输量。

2、压缩图片:工具与技巧

压缩图片是减少文件大小的另一有效手段。市面上有许多优秀的图片压缩工具,如TinyPNG、ImageOptim等,它们通过算法优化,在不明显影响图片质量的前提下,大幅降低文件大小。使用这些工具时,应注意平衡压缩比和图片质量,避免过度压缩导致图片失真。此外,手动调整图片的分辨率和色彩深度也是有效的压缩技巧,尤其适用于背景图和大尺寸图片。

3、懒加载技术:按需加载图片

懒加载技术是一种智能的图片加载方式,它仅在用户滚动到页面特定位置时才加载图片,从而减少初始加载时间。这种技术特别适用于图片密集型的网页,如电商网站和博客。实现懒加载的常用方法包括使用JavaScript库(如LazyLoad)或利用现代浏览器的Intersection Observer API。通过懒加载,不仅能提升页面加载速度,还能节省用户流量,提升用户体验。

综上所述,优化图片是提升网页加载速度的重要环节。通过选择合适的图片格式、合理压缩图片以及应用懒加载技术,可以显著减少页面加载时间,提升用户体验和SEO排名。

二、精简代码:提升加载效率

1、HTML优化:删除冗余标签

HTML作为网页的骨架,其简洁性直接影响加载速度。删除不必要的标签是首要任务。例如,多余的

嵌套、无内容的标签等,都会增加DOM树的复杂度,延长解析时间。通过使用语义化标签如

,不仅能提升代码的可读性,还能减少无意义的标签使用。

2、CSS精简:合并与压缩

CSS文件的大小直接影响页面的渲染速度。合并多个CSS文件为一个,减少HTTP请求次数,是常见的优化手段。使用工具如CSS Minifier进行压缩,去除空格、注释等无关紧要的内容,能显著减小文件体积。此外,避免使用复杂的CSS选择器,减少层叠和继承,也是提升CSS效率的关键。

3、JavaScript优化:异步加载与模块化

JavaScript是网页交互的核心,但其加载和执行过程容易阻塞渲染。采用异步加载(如asyncdefer属性),可以让JS文件在后台加载,不阻塞DOM的解析。模块化则是将大文件拆分为多个小模块,按需加载,减少初始加载时间。使用现代框架如React或Vue,自带模块化特性,能有效提升JS的加载效率。

通过以上三方面的代码精简,不仅能减少文件体积,还能提升解析和执行速度,从而显著提高网页的加载效率。

三、利用缓存与CDN:加速内容传输

1、浏览器缓存:减少重复加载

浏览器缓存是提高网页加载速度的利器。通过合理设置HTTP缓存头,可以让浏览器存储已加载的资源,如图片、CSS和JavaScript文件。当用户再次访问时,浏览器会优先从本地缓存中读取,减少服务器请求次数,从而大幅提升加载速度。常见的缓存头包括Cache-ControlExpiresETag。例如,设置Cache-Control: max-age=31536000,表示资源在一年内无需重新请求。

2、CDN服务:全球加速的秘密

内容分发网络(CDN)通过在全球部署多个节点,将静态资源分发到离用户最近的节点,从而减少数据传输距离,提升加载速度。CDN不仅提高了访问速度,还能有效应对高并发访问,防止服务器过载。知名CDN服务商如Cloudflare、Akamai等,提供了丰富的配置选项,支持自定义缓存规则、SSL加密等功能,确保内容传输既快速又安全。

3、缓存策略:最佳实践与注意事项

制定合理的缓存策略是关键。首先,根据资源类型和更新频率,设置不同的缓存时长。例如,对于不常变更的静态资源,可以设置较长的缓存时间;而对于频繁更新的动态内容,则应缩短缓存时间或使用no-cache策略。其次,利用ETag标签,确保资源更新时浏览器能够正确识别并重新加载。此外,还需注意缓存清理机制,避免过期资源影响用户体验。

在实际应用中,缓存策略需结合网站具体情况灵活调整。例如,对于电商网站,产品图片和详情页的缓存策略应有所不同,以确保用户始终看到最新的信息。总之,合理利用缓存与CDN,不仅能大幅提升网页加载速度,还能优化用户体验,提升SEO排名。

结语:综合优化,提升网页性能

在当今互联网时代,网页加载速度直接影响用户体验和SEO排名。通过优化图片、精简代码和利用缓存与CDN服务,我们可以显著提升网页性能。选择WebP格式、压缩图片、实施懒加载技术,有效减少了文件大小和加载时间。删除冗余HTML标签、合并压缩CSS文件、异步加载JavaScript模块,进一步提升了代码效率。利用浏览器缓存和CDN服务,更是加速了内容传输,减少了服务器负载。综合这些优化措施,不仅能提升用户体验,还能在搜索引擎中获得更高的排名。展望未来,随着技术的不断进步,网页性能优化将更加智能化和自动化。我们鼓励读者持续关注最新趋势,积极实践,不断优化自己的网页,以应对日益激烈的市场竞争。

常见问题

1、为什么图片格式对加载速度有影响?

图片格式直接影响文件大小和加载时间。传统格式如JPEG和PNG虽然常见,但文件较大。WebP格式结合了两者优点,提供更高压缩率,相同质量下文件更小,显著提升加载速度。选择合适格式是优化网页性能的第一步。

2、如何在不影响功能的前提下精简代码?

精简代码需平衡功能与效率。删除冗余HTML标签,合并CSS文件并压缩,使用Minify工具。JavaScript优化则通过异步加载和模块化,避免阻塞渲染。保持代码结构清晰,确保功能完整的同时,减少加载负担。

3、CDN服务如何选择和配置?

选择CDN服务需考虑覆盖范围、节点数量和价格。配置时,确保正确设置缓存策略,如缓存时长和缓存内容类型。监控CDN性能,定期调整配置,以最大化加速效果。合理利用CDN,可大幅提升全球用户访问速度。

4、浏览器缓存有哪些常见问题?

浏览器缓存常见问题包括缓存过期、缓存不一致和缓存未生效。设置合理的缓存时长,使用强缓存和协商缓存策略,确保内容更新及时。避免缓存滥用,定期清理缓存,防止用户访问过时内容。合理配置缓存,提升重复访问速度。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/83560.html

Like (0)
路飞SEO的头像路飞SEO编辑
Previous 2025-06-14 13:22
Next 2025-06-14 13:23

相关推荐

  • 如何添加地方天气预报

    要在网站或应用中添加地方天气预报,首先选择可靠的天气API服务,如OpenWeatherMap或WeatherAPI。注册并获取API密钥后,根据API文档编写代码,调用相应接口获取特定地区的天气数据。将数据解析并展示在前端界面,确保用户体验良好。定期更新API密钥和数据,保证服务的稳定性和准确性。

    2025-06-14
    0497
  • 万网云主机怎么样

    万网云主机以其稳定性和高性能著称,适合各类企业和开发者。提供多种配置选择,满足不同需求。强大的技术支持和24/7监控确保服务稳定,用户评价普遍较高,是值得信赖的云主机服务。

    2025-06-10
    02
  • 如何找回误删的小游戏

    误删小游戏不用急,找回其实很简单。首先,检查电脑回收站或手机垃圾箱,看是否能直接恢复。若不行,尝试使用数据恢复软件如Recuva或Disk Drill扫描设备,找回删除文件。若在云端游戏平台,登录账号查看是否存有游戏记录。预防未来误删,建议定期备份游戏数据。

    2025-06-14
    0352
  • 建网站需要注意什么

    建网站需注意:1. 明确目标用户,设计符合用户需求的界面;2. 选择稳定可靠的主机和域名;3. 优化SEO,确保网站易被搜索引擎收录;4. 确保网站加载速度快,提升用户体验;5. 注重内容质量,提供有价值的信息;6. 加强网站安全,防止数据泄露。

  • wordpress如何开启gzip

    开启WordPress的Gzip压缩可以加快网站加载速度。首先,通过FTP或文件管理器进入WordPress根目录,找到并编辑`.htaccess`文件。在文件中添加以下代码:`
    AddOutputFilterByType DEFLATE text/plain text/html text/xml text/css application/javascript application/x-javascript image/svg+xml
    `。保存后,使用在线工具如GTmetrix检查Gzip是否已启用。此方法适用于Apache服务器。

  • 启航做网站怎么样

    启航做网站以其专业的设计和高效的建站服务著称,适合各类企业和个人用户。其团队经验丰富,提供定制化解决方案,确保网站不仅美观还具备良好的SEO性能。客户反馈普遍好评,性价比高,是初创企业和小型公司的理想选择。

    2025-06-17
    037
  • 什么是建设前期

    建设前期是指在正式开工建设之前进行的各项准备工作,包括项目可行性研究、土地审批、资金筹措、设计规划等。这一阶段是项目成功的基础,直接影响后续施工的顺利进行。重视建设前期工作,可以有效避免项目风险,确保投资效益最大化。

    2025-06-19
    0190
  • app分享页面怎么做

    创建app分享页面,首先确定分享内容,如链接、图片或文本。使用前端技术如HTML、CSS和JavaScript设计页面,确保界面简洁易用。集成社交媒体API,方便用户一键分享。测试在不同设备和浏览器上的兼容性,优化加载速度,提升用户体验。

    2025-06-10
    01
  • 风险网站怎么解决方法

    要解决风险网站问题,首先需确认风险类型,如恶意软件、钓鱼链接等。使用专业安全工具进行全面扫描和清理,更新网站安全插件,修复漏洞。加强密码管理,采用多因素认证。定期备份网站数据,确保数据安全。同时,监控网站流量异常,及时发现并处理潜在威胁。

    2025-06-11
    03

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注